Thanks for sharing. As of November 11th, I've had a fistula. It's horrible. Pus and blood come out of it, and if I pass gas, I feel what feels like a bee sting as the gas is actually partly traveling through the fistula tunnel thing. Really sucks. I have now figured out to apply pressure with my finger on the fistula to stop that bee sting feeling so that the gas passes through the anus normally.

Can't wait to get surgery for this.
